Soluble SARS-CoV-2 Spike glycoprotein: considering some potential pathogenic effects
The soluble S1 subunit of Spike protein (SP) from the SARS‐CoV-2 of different variants of concern (VOCs) may directly bind and activate human NK cells in vitro through the engagement of the toll-like receptor (TLR) 2 and TLR4.
